  13. The Future Of Software Development Companies In The 'Vibe Coding' Era

    The software development landscape is shifting towards "vibe coding," where developers direct AI tools rather than writing code line by line. This evolution redefines the value proposition of software outsourcing companies, moving from "developers as a service" to delivering business outcomes. While AI coding tools offer significant speed multipliers, they also introduce risks such as increased security vulnerabilities and maintenance issues, highlighting the growing importance of trust, governance, and validation in AI-driven development.   18. 2 Tell-Tale Signs Of ‘Fake Love’ In A Relationship, By A Psychologist

    A psychologist identifies two key indicators of inauthentic relationships, often only recognized in hindsight. The first is "love-bombing," characterized by excessive affection and rapid escalation of intimacy, which can be mistaken for deep investment but may serve to gain control. The second is "conditional positive regard," where affection is dependent on a partner's behavior, mood, or compliance, rather than being a stable foundation. AI

  20. The weight of silk: what the honour means for the Inner Bar as an institution

    The Inner Bar, a prestigious legal designation, is not merely a recognition of commercial success but a public commitment to the court and the legal profession. This honor signifies a transfer of responsibility, requiring senior counsel to lead not only in advocacy but also in judgment, temperament, and service. Historically, the rank emerged in Tudor England as royal advisers entrusted by the Crown to counsel on the interests of the realm, embodying institutional confidence. AI

  21. Barney Frank, legendary liberal who ripped into left-wing dysfunction on his death bed, dies at 86

    Barney Frank, a prominent liberal congressman known for his advocacy for gay rights and financial reforms, has passed away at the age of 86. Throughout his 32-year tenure in Congress, Frank was recognized for his sharp wit and pragmatic approach to politics. He was a trailblazer for LGBT rights, becoming the first openly gay member of Congress and the first incumbent to marry a same-sex partner. Frank also emphasized the importance of achieving progressive goals through conventional political methods, cautioning against alienating moderate voters with overly radical agendas. AI
